The Pip-Boy is a promotional miscellaneous item in Team Fortress 2 videogame by Valve.

The device is modeled after the Pip-Boy 3000 series produced by RobCo Industries. When equipped, the Pip-Boy features a revised PDA HUD to match the looks of the device.

Notes

  • A Genuine Pip-Boy was awarded to all players who owned Fallout: New Vegas before August 8, 2011.

Update history

August 3, 2011 Patch

  • The Pip-Boy was added to the game.

August 4, 2011 [Item schema update]

  • Changed name from "Pip-Boy 1950" to "Pip-Boy".

August 9, 2011 Patch

  • This item can be purchased, traded, crafted, gifted and found in random drops.
